Summary
AeroVironment has been awarded a contract to supply three autonomous helicopters for NASA's Skyfall mission to Mars. The contract value is not disclosed, but it represents a high-profile validation of the company's autonomous flight technology in a space exploration context. This follows a turbulent period for the company, including a $265.1 million net loss in FY2026 and a securities fraud class action lawsuit. The award could signal renewed confidence in AeroVironment's capabilities and may support its Space unit, which recently took a $241 million goodwill impairment.
